A dreaded gangster, wanted in at least 30 criminal cases, was shot dead near a temple in Jharkhand`s Dumka district in the early hours of Friday by men who were dressed as `kanwariyas`, police said.
Amarnath Singh, a resident of Jamshedpur, went to Basukinath temple in Dumka along with his family to offer obeisance in the holy month of `Shravan` when the gunmen shot him from point blank range, they said.
